CONC 6.3.1RRP
This section applies:(1) to a firm with respect to consumer credit lending; and(2) where a firm has entered into a current account agreement where:(a) there is a possibility that the account-holder may be allowed to overdraw on the current account without a pre-arranged overdraft or exceed a pre-arranged overdraft limit; and (b) if the account-holder did so, this would be a regulated credit agreement.

SUP 10A.10.3GRP
The customer function has to do with giving advice on, dealing and arranging deals in and managing investments; it has no application to banking business such as deposit taking and lending, nor to general insurance business or credit-related regulated activity1.

CONC 5A.3.1RRP
This section applies to: (1) a firm with respect to consumer credit lending; (2) a firm with respect to debt administration; (3) a firm with respect to debt collecting; or(4) a firm with respect to operating an electronic system in relation to lending.

CONC 4.1.1RRP
1This section, apart from CONC 4.1.4 R, applies to: (1) a firm with respect to consumer credit lending; or (2) a firm with respect to consumer hiring;including where the firm provides a quotation acting on behalf of a customer.
